Description:
N1-Beta-D-galactopyranosyl amino-guanidine HNO3, with the CAS number 109853-86-3, is a chemical compound that features a beta-D-galactopyranosyl moiety linked to an amino-guanidine structure. This compound is characterized by its potential biological activity, particularly in the context of glycation processes and its role in various biochemical pathways. The presence of the guanidine group suggests that it may exhibit properties related to nitric oxide synthesis and could have implications in pharmacological applications, particularly in the treatment of conditions associated with oxidative stress and inflammation. The nitrate component (HNO3) indicates that the compound may also possess unique solubility and reactivity characteristics, influencing its stability and interaction with other biological molecules. Overall, this compound is of interest in medicinal chemistry and biochemistry, particularly for its potential therapeutic applications and its role in metabolic processes.
